Official packages with all relevant dependency requirements are available on
https://nightly.odoo.com.
Windows
-------
* download https://nightly.odoo.com/8.0/nightly/exe/odoo_8.0.latest.exe
* run the downloaded file
.. warning:: on Windows 8, you may see a warning titled "Windows protected
your PC". Click :guilabel:`More Info` then
:guilabel:`Run anyway`
* Accept the UAC_ prompt
* Go through the various installation steps
Odoo will automatically be started at the end of the installation.
Configuration
'''''''''''''
The :ref:`configuration file <reference/cmdline/config>` can be found at
:file:`{%PROGRAMFILES%}\\Odoo 8.0-{id}\\server\\openerp-server.conf`.
The configuration file can be edited to connect to a remote Postgresql, edit
file locations or set a dbfilter.
To reload the configuration file, restart the Odoo service via
:menuselection:`Services --> odoo server`.

.. _setup/install/vcs:
VCS Checkout
============
The VCS Checkout installation method is similar to
:ref:`source-based installation <setup/install/source>` in most respect.
* Instead of downloading a tarball the Odoo source code is downloaded from
`the repository`_ using git_
* This simplifies the development and contributions to Odoo itself
* This also simplifies maintaining non-module patches on top of the base Odoo
system
The primary drawback of the VCS checkout method is that it is significantly
larger than a :ref:`source install <setup/install/source>` as it contains
the entire history of the Odoo project.
